Fischer wrote: >>> Hi! >>> >>> _Background_ >>> In my project a record all drawing operations to a recording >>> surface. >>> Finally, to output files I create surfaces of specific backends >>> (PNG, >>> PDF, and SVG) and "crop" (the final surface is smaller than the >>> recording source surface), rotate, and paint the recording surface >>> to it. >>> >>> >>> _Strange Behavior_ >>> When using PDF as backend, not everything is painted from the >>> source >>> (recording) surface to the PDF surface. On PNG and SVG it works as >>> expected. >>> >>> >>> _Examples_ >>> There is a PNG and PDF example to show the behavior. Look at the >>> right >>> lower corner: right of the string "015°30" the short black lines >>> in the >>> axis are missing compared to the PNG. >>> http://www.abenteuerland.at/download/eagle/output.pdf >>> http://www.abenteuerland.at/download/eagle/output.png >>> >>> >>> _Trigger_ >>> I observed, that this behavior is triggered as soon as the PDF >>> surface >>> is smaller than the recording surface. >>> >>> >>> _Code Snippet_ >>> The following code snippets shows how I create the PDF and PNG >>> surface >>> from the recording surface (sfc_). >>> >>> >>> /* create PDF from sfc_ */ >>> sfc = cairo_pdf_surface_create("output.pdf", width*.7, >>> height*1.3); >>> dst = cairo_create(sfc); >>> cairo_rotate(dst, DEG2RAD(15)); >>> cairo_set_source_surface(dst, sfc_, 0, 0); >>> cairo_paint(dst); >>> cairo_show_page(dst); >>> cairo_destroy(dst); >>> cairo_surface_destroy(sfc); >>> >>> >>> /* create PNG from sfc_ */ >>> sfc = cairo_image_surface_create(CAIRO_FORMAT_RGB24, >>> width*.7, >>> height*1.3); >>> dst = cairo_create(sfc); >>> cairo_rotate(dst, DEG2RAD(15)); >>> cairo_set_source_surface(dst, sfc_, 0, 0); >>> cairo_paint(dst); >>> cairo_show_page(dst); >>> cairo_destroy(dst); >>> cairo_surface_write_to_png(sfc, "output.png"); >>> cairo_surface_destroy(sfc); >>> >>> >>> Any hints appreciated. >> >> If you can provide a simple test case that reproduces the bug with >> the >> current version of cairo I can look into it. >> > > Hi! > > Please find attached a simple test program which demonstrates it. > I tested it on Cairo 1.14.6 and 1.14.0. > > > Bernhard > > > -- > cairo mailing list > [email protected] > https://lists.cairographics.org/mailman/listinfo/cairo -- cairo mailing list [email protected] https://lists.cairographics.org/mailman/listinfo/cairo
